Whippet Snoozing
Whippets are outstanding at snoozing and all sleep-related activities. By far their preferred style is sleeping in bed under the blankets in the winter; however they will also force themselves under the covers in the summer, radiating heat and breathing their hot breath into your armpit.

Whippets will also sleep on the sofa, in virtually any chair, and outside on lawn furniture. They enjoy basking in the sun and may lie in the same spot on the lawn for hours, drugging themselves into a stupor with sun and sleep. Many Whippets will also stuff themselves into small cat baskets, curling themselves up very tightly. No special breeding or training is required for this activity; however a soft cushion or blankie is mandatory.
If you must spend any amount of time in bed because of illness, or just a general tendency to sloth, then the Whippet is the breed for you!
